Description

This novel chronicles the final decline of a poor white family in rural Georgia, who are exhorted by their patriarch, Ty Ty, to dig up their land in search of gold, and who thereby ruin it. Complex sexual entanglements and betrayals lead to a murder within the family that completes its dissolution.
